The Secret Sauce: Quantity Over Quality 📹

Why Focusing on Quantity First Matters

Contrary to popular belief, producing more content often trumps the pursuit of perfection. Most people delay creating because they want their content to be flawless. But social media functions differently—volume enables growth because:

  • Iteration: Regular publishing accelerates skill improvement.
  • Discoverability: The more content you produce, the more likely the algorithm is to notice you.
  • Overcoming Fear: Early content WILL be messy. Accepting imperfection minimizes procrastination.

Nick shared an insightful anecdote from a photography class study: A group told to focus on quantity over time produced objectively better photos than the group focused on creating one perfect shot. The takeaway? Repetition leads to mastery.

Build Systems That Scale 🚀

Automating Content Creation: Minimize Friction

One of Nick’s greatest insights is the importance of minimizing any kind of friction in production. If operational barriers (e.g., long editing times, indecision, or labor-intensive setup) slow you down, consistency suffers. Instead, create a system where:

  • Content ideas are automated. Nick uses YouTube comment scrapers to pull audience feedback and requests.
  • Videos are recorded rapidly. Tools such as OBS allow for live productions without tedious post-processing steps.
  • Templates streamline processes. From thumbnails to scripts, templating organizes repetitive tasks.

Nick’s 3-Step System: From Ideas to Views 📈

  1. Idea Generation: Discover what the audience wants to see!!
  • Use data-driven methods like scraping YouTube comments (e.g., recurring questions).
  • Repurpose high-performing competitor topics.
  1. Production: Make creation seamless!
  • Use templates for videos, thumbnail design, and scripts.
  • Integrate tools such as Canva for thumbnails and OBS Studio for live editing workflows.
  1. Distribution: Focus only on the essentials (posting and scheduling vs. over-complicating promo).

Compound Growth: The Creator’s Formula 📈

Content Snowball Effect

The growth curve in content creation isn’t linear. One unit of effort initially results in less visible output but has compounding returns later. Every video you upload bolsters the potential success of future uploads. Think of Nick’s analogy of storing black powder: Even “failed” videos increase the potential energy for a channel-wide explosion.


What This Means for You 🌟

Nick illustrates how growth heavily correlates with total watch time accumulated over time (not individual video success). Each piece strengthens your library and increases the chances of winning algorithms.
